Application
- Asymmetric Catalysis by Architectural and Functional Molecular Engineering: Practical Chemo- and Stereoselective Hydrogenation of Ketones.: The study showcases the role of 2-propanol in asymmetric catalysis, providing an efficient method for the stereoselective hydrogenation of ketones, which is vital in pharmaceutical synthesis (Noyori and Ohkuma, 2001).
- Electrospray ionization mass spectrometry of synthetic oligonucleotides using 2-propanol and spermidine.: This research examines the use of 2-propanol in electrospray ionization mass spectrometry, enhancing the detection and analysis of synthetic oligonucleotides (De Bellis et al., 2000).
- Isolation, identification, and chemical synthesis of 8 alpha,25-dihydroxy-9,10-seco-4,6,10(19)-cholestatrien-3-one. A new metabolite of 25-hydroxyvitamin D3 produced by mouse myeloid leukemia cells (M1).: This study details the use of 2-propanol in the chemical synthesis of a new vitamin D3 metabolite, which is significant for understanding vitamin D metabolism in leukemia cells (Yamada et al., 1987).
